Skip to content

Commit fe96710

Browse files
committed
Code review feedback
1 parent 74e08f3 commit fe96710

File tree

9 files changed

+11
-7
lines changed

9 files changed

+11
-7
lines changed

go.mod

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@ require (
1414
go.temporal.io/api v1.53.0
1515
go.temporal.io/sdk v1.35.0
1616
go.temporal.io/sdk/contrib/envconfig v0.1.0
17-
go.temporal.io/server v1.29.0-142.0
17+
go.temporal.io/server v1.28.1
1818
k8s.io/api v0.34.0
1919
k8s.io/apimachinery v0.34.0
2020
k8s.io/client-go v0.34.0
@@ -152,6 +152,7 @@ require (
152152
go.opentelemetry.io/otel/sdk/metric v1.34.0 // indirect
153153
go.opentelemetry.io/otel/trace v1.34.0 // indirect
154154
go.opentelemetry.io/proto/otlp v1.5.0 // indirect
155+
go.temporal.io/version v0.3.0 // indirect
155156
go.uber.org/atomic v1.11.0 // indirect
156157
go.uber.org/dig v1.18.0 // indirect
157158
go.uber.org/fx v1.23.0 // indirect

go.sum

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-386,8 +386,6 @@ github.com/zeebo/errs v1.4.0 h1:XNdoD/RRMKP7HD0UhJnIzUy74ISdGGxURlYG8HSWSfM=
386386
github.com/zeebo/errs v1.4.0/go.mod h1:sgbWHsvVuTPHcqJJGQ1WhI5KbWlHYz+2+2C/LSEtCw4=
387387
go.opentelemetry.io/auto/sdk v1.1.0 h1:cH53jehLUN6UFLY71z+NDOiNJqDdPRaXzTel0sJySYA=
388388
go.opentelemetry.io/auto/sdk v1.1.0/go.mod h1:3wSPjt5PWp2RhlCcmmOial7AvC4DQqZb7a7wCow3W8A=
389-
go.opentelemetry.io/collector/pdata v1.34.0 h1:2vwYftckXe7pWxI9mfSo+tw3wqdGNrYpMbDx/5q6rw8=
390-
go.opentelemetry.io/collector/pdata v1.34.0/go.mod h1:StPHMFkhLBellRWrULq0DNjv4znCDJZP6La4UuC+JHI=
391389
go.opentelemetry.io/contrib/detectors/gcp v1.34.0 h1:JRxssobiPg23otYU5SbWtQC//snGVIM3Tx6QRzlQBao=
392390
go.opentelemetry.io/contrib/detectors/gcp v1.34.0/go.mod h1:cV4BMFcscUR/ckqLkbfQmF0PRsq8w/lMGzdbCSveBHo=
393391
go.opentelemetry.io/contrib/instrumentation/google.golang.org/grpc/otelgrpc v0.59.0 h1:rgMkmiGfix9vFJDcDi1PK8WEQP4FLQwLDfhp5ZLpFeE=
@@ -422,8 +420,10 @@ go.temporal.io/sdk v1.35.0 h1:lRNAQ5As9rLgYa7HBvnmKyzxLcdElTuoFJ0FXM/AsLQ=
422420
go.temporal.io/sdk v1.35.0/go.mod h1:1q5MuLc2MEJ4lneZTHJzpVebW2oZnyxoIOWX3oFVebw=
423421
go.temporal.io/sdk/contrib/envconfig v0.1.0 h1:s+G/Ujph+Xl2jzLiiIm2T1vuijDkUL4Kse49dgDVGBE=
424422
go.temporal.io/sdk/contrib/envconfig v0.1.0/go.mod h1:FQEO3C56h9C7M6sDgSanB8HnBTmopw9qgVx4F1S6pJk=
425-
go.temporal.io/server v1.29.0-142.0 h1:8uCRD7xWzlEaiAaxj/rg/Y5iIXx3ggyjwwVZHATe8JY=
426-
go.temporal.io/server v1.29.0-142.0/go.mod h1:pc0n6DRcN06V4WNhaxdxE3KaZIS3KSDNKdca6uu6RuU=
423+
go.temporal.io/server v1.28.1 h1:koDHINsed1onr/TpLfYWINbTBmFQLRUfU5LtPlxjvLQ=
424+
go.temporal.io/server v1.28.1/go.mod h1:QcXPBkDo/WOwq3NPVrT4KsYczsgxvW0bKg489qPn0QU=
425+
go.temporal.io/version v0.3.0 h1:dMrei9l9NyHt8nG6EB8vAwDLLTwx2SvRyucCSumAiig=
426+
go.temporal.io/version v0.3.0/go.mod h1:UA9S8/1LaKYae6TyD9NaPMJTZb911JcbqghI2CBSP78=
427427
go.uber.org/atomic v1.5.0/go.mod h1:sABNBOSYdrvTF6hTgEIbc7YasKWGhgEQZyfxyTvoXHQ=
428428
go.uber.org/atomic v1.7.0/go.mod h1:fEN4uk6kAWBTFdckzkM89CLk9XfWZrxpCo0nPH17wJc=
429429
go.uber.org/atomic v1.11.0 h1:ZvwS0R+56ePWxUNi+Atn9dWONBPp/AUETXlHW0DxSjE=

internal/demo/helloworld/helm/helloworld/templates/deployment.yaml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
1-
#file: noinspection KubernetesUnknownResourcesInspection
1+
# This template creates a TemporalWorkerDeployment custom resource that manages
2+
# the lifecycle of Temporal worker pods, including progressive rollouts and scaling
23
apiVersion: temporal.io/v1alpha1
34
kind: TemporalWorkerDeployment
45
metadata:
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.

internal/demo/util/observability.go

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-36,6 +36,8 @@ func configureObservability(buildID string, metricsPort int) (l log.Logger, m op
3636
InitialAttributes: attribute.NewSet(attribute.String("version", buildID)),
3737
})
3838

39+
// TODO(jlegrone): Expose these metrics in the demo to show worker performance
40+
// and rollout progress. Metrics include temporal_request_total, temporal_workflow_completed, etc.
3941
go func() {
4042
addr := fmt.Sprintf(":%d", metricsPort)
4143
slogger.Info("Serving metrics", slog.String("address", fmt.Sprintf("localhost%s/metrics", addr)))

skaffold.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-65,7 +65,7 @@ deploy:
6565
hooks:
6666
before:
6767
- host:
68-
command: ["./hack/update_chart_version.sh"]
68+
command: ["./internal/demo/scripts/update_chart_version.sh"]
6969
after:
7070
- host:
7171
command: ["sh", "-c", "sed -i '' 's/appVersion: .*/appVersion: \"automated\"/' internal/demo/helloworld/helm/helloworld/Chart.yaml"]

0 commit comments

Comments
 (0)